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_005711.5(EDIL3):c.867A>G(p.Ile289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,648 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. I289V) has been classified as Likely benign.

Genes affected
EDIL3 (HGNC:3173): (EGF like repeats and discoidin domains 3) The protein encoded by this gene is an integrin ligand. It plays an important role in mediating angiogenesis and may be important in vessel wall remodeling and development. It also influences endothelial cell behavior.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 18, 2022The c.867A>G (p.I289M) alteration is located in exon 8 (coding exon 8) of the EDIL3 gene. This alteration results from a A to G substitution at nucleotide position 867, causing the isoleucine (I) at amino acid position 289 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
